Candi Dempster
CNQ Board | Communications & Marketing

I have been involved in cricket since I was 12 years of age. I played women’s cricket in Brisbane for many years as well as coached U/17 boys and also girls teams. In my youth, I was fortunate to play for Queensland in both the U/18 and U/21 sides.
Cricket is a game of skill, teamwork and intelligence. It builds a sense of confidence, fun and purpose in participants as the team grows to know each other, and the game. Cricket also builds character as you have to respect each other and have perseverance and resilience to work together to get the job done.
I always remember a quote from one of my coaches-
“It only takes one lapse of concentration to miss a ball and get out. Be calm, confident and focus. You can’t score runs from the shed”.
I’ve always wanted to be involved and out in the field, rather than being in the shed.
It’s a joy to be on the board and a part of Cricket North Queensland, contributing to build the sport I love and one that has given so much to me over the years.
​
Professionally, Candi is also the Principal of Ryan Catholic College, Townsville. She brings extensive leadership and communication skills and experience to the CNQ board.
